I'm looking for a selfhostable calendar web app that I could connect to my already running Baikal setup. I know nextcloud has a calendar, but I don't necessarily want to bother with a whole nextcloud installation.
Anyone know a webapp for that?

I haven't tested the spouse approval factor, but once Radicale is setup, you don't have to do anything other than create new calendars through a caldav app, or through the web front end.

Android can use DavX to sync if you're in to foss stuff

I pretty much only use it for tasks and a maintenance calendar, but I've had zero problems with it so far
